Oaxaca Sunset

Hibiscus & citrus

Hibiscus · Citrus · Refined

Tart hibiscus, bright citrus, and an orange-peel aroma.

Hibiscus and mezcal are natural partners — this version keeps the ingredients simple, with no specialty liqueur required.

Make it

  1. 1Shake the mezcal, lime juice, and hibiscus syrup with ice for 12 seconds.
  2. 2Strain into a rocks glass over fresh ice.
  3. 3Squeeze the orange peel over the drink and add it as the garnish.

Make this first

Organic hibiscus syrup for Oaxaca Sunset

  1. Pour the boiling water over the hibiscus flowers. Steep for 5 minutes and strain.
  2. Add enough water to restore the strained tea to 120 ml.
  3. While warm, dissolve the cane sugar into it. Cool completely.

Prepare small batches, refrigerate promptly in clean, covered containers, and use them fresh.

Good to know

Keep the orange peel as the single garnish — its color against the hibiscus is the whole show.
